    What you can control with Harmony

    Harmony remotes and hubs can control a wide range of devices using:

    • Infrared (IR) for TVs, set-top boxes, DVD/Blu‑ray players, receivers.
    • Wi‑Fi for many smart devices and for the Harmony Hub to communicate with Logitech’s cloud services.
    • Bluetooth for some streaming devices and game consoles (via the Harmony Hub).
    • Smart home integrations via built‑in support or cloud-to-cloud connections for brands like Philips Hue, LIFX, Nest (thermostats), Honeywell, Sonos, Roku, Amazon Fire TV, and smart plugs/switches that expose an API.

    Requirements and preparations

    • A compatible Harmony remote (with Harmony Hub recommended for smart home control).
    • Harmony Remote Software or the Harmony mobile app (log in to your Logitech account).
    • Wi‑Fi network for the Harmony Hub and smart devices.
    • Manufacturer accounts for cloud-based services (e.g., Philips Hue account).
    • Up‑to‑date firmware for your remote, Hub, and smart devices.

    Tip: Keep a list of device model numbers and account credentials handy during setup.


    Step 1 — Install and sign in

    1. Install the Harmony desktop software on Windows or macOS, or download the Harmony app on iOS/Android.
    2. Sign in with your Logitech account. If you don’t have one, create it — this account stores your device configuration.
    3. If using a Hub-based remote, connect the Harmony Hub to power and your Wi‑Fi network (follow the in-app setup prompts).

    Step 2 — Add entertainment devices

    1. In the Harmony app/software choose “Devices” → “Add Device.”
    2. Enter brand and model number (or select from the database).
    3. Test basic commands (power, volume, input) to ensure IR/Bluetooth control works.
    4. Repeat for each entertainment device (TV, receiver, streaming box).

    Note: For some devices the Hub can control them over Wi‑Fi—choose the Wi‑Fi option when prompted if supported.


    Step 3 — Add smart home devices and services

    Harmony supports both direct device control and integrations with cloud services.

    Direct/local integrations (via Hub or Wi‑Fi):

    • Philips Hue: Add Hue Bridge in “Devices” or “Services,” then authenticate the Hue account or press the bridge button as prompted. Harmony can control lights, dimming, and scenes.
    • LIFX: Add LIFX account or local device; control bulbs and basic color/brightness.
    • Smart plugs/switches: Many Zigbee/Z‑Wave or Wi‑Fi plugs that expose an API can be added via brand selection.

    Cloud-to-cloud services (requires account linking):

    • Nest/Thermostats: Link your Nest account to allow temperature control and modes.
    • Sonos: Link Sonos account to play/pause and control zones.
    • SmartThings / Samsung: Link account to access devices managed by SmartThings.
    • Amazon Alexa / Google Assistant: Link accounts if you want voice assistant interoperability.

    To add a service:

    1. Open “Services” or “Add Device/Service” in the Harmony app.
    2. Select the service (e.g., Philips Hue, Nest), sign in to the provider when prompted, and grant necessary permissions.
    3. Assign devices/rooms and test control.

    Step 4 — Create Activities that combine devices and smart actions

    Activities are the heart of Harmony — they run multiple devices and smart actions with one command.

    Examples:

    • “Watch TV” Activity: Turns on TV, AV receiver, sets TV input, and dims lights to 20%.
    • “Movie Night” Activity: Powers TV and receiver, sets surround sound, closes smart shades, and sets lights to a movie scene (via Hue).
    • “Gaming” Activity: Powers gaming console and TV, switches receiver to console input, sets lights brighter.

    To create an Activity:

    1. In the app: choose “Activities” → “Create New Activity.”
    2. Pick the initial device (e.g., TV) and additional devices used in the Activity.
    3. Define the sequence (power on TV, then receiver, then set inputs).
    4. Add smart home commands (turn lights on/off, set scene, adjust thermostat) — these are usually available after you’ve linked the relevant services.
    5. Save and test; tweak command delays if devices need time to boot.

    Step 5 — Use macros and custom commands for advanced control

    • Custom commands: If a device function isn’t in the default command list, you can learn an IR command from an original remote (Hub learns IR) or create a macro that sequences commands with delays.
    • Timed sequences: Insert pauses between commands when a device takes longer to respond (e.g., consoles that need extra boot time).
    • Conditional activities: While Harmony’s native logic is limited, you can combine Harmony with Alexa/Google routines or SmartThings automations for conditional behavior (e.g., “If front door opens after 9 PM, turn on hallway lights and start camera”).

    Step 6 — Organize by rooms and favorites

    • Assign devices and Activities to rooms for simpler navigation in the app and remote.
    • Use Favorites and Quick Access buttons on compatible remotes to map streaming apps or frequently used commands (Netflix, Prime Video, etc.).
    • Create separate Activities for shared devices if multiple people use different setups (e.g., “Kids TV” vs “Adult TV”).

    Troubleshooting common issues

    • Device not responding: Re-check line-of-sight for IR devices, ensure Hub is on the same Wi‑Fi, and verify device model entry.
    • Smart service won’t link: Re-authenticate the third‑party account, ensure two‑factor auth hasn’t blocked the connection, and check for firmware updates.
    • Activity sequence problems: Add or adjust delays between commands; re-order device power sequence.
    • Hub offline: Reboot router and Hub, confirm Wi‑Fi password hasn’t changed, or try moving Hub closer to the router.

    What is InterMapper RemoteAccess?

    InterMapper RemoteAccess is a powerful network monitoring and management tool designed to provide real-time visibility into network performance. It allows IT professionals to monitor network devices, track performance metrics, and troubleshoot issues from anywhere, making it an essential solution for remote network management. With its intuitive interface and comprehensive features, InterMapper RemoteAccess empowers organizations to maintain optimal network performance and minimize downtime.

    What is Kaspersky Secure Connection?

    Kaspersky Secure Connection is a VPN service offered by Kaspersky Lab, a well-known name in cybersecurity. This service encrypts your internet connection, making it difficult for hackers, ISPs, and other entities to monitor your online activities. By masking your IP address, Kaspersky Secure Connection allows you to browse the internet anonymously.

    How to Effectively Compare Sheets in Excel: A Step-by-Step GuideComparing sheets in Excel is a common task for many users, especially when dealing with large datasets or multiple versions of a file. Whether you’re looking to identify differences in data, track changes, or consolidate information, Excel offers several methods to make this process efficient and effective. This guide will walk you through various techniques to compare sheets in Excel, ensuring you can easily spot discrepancies and manage your data effectively.


    Understanding the Need for Comparison

    Before diving into the methods, it’s essential to understand why you might need to compare sheets. Common scenarios include:

    • Identifying Changes: When multiple users edit a file, you may want to see what has changed.
    • Data Validation: Ensuring that data entries are consistent across different sheets.
    • Merging Data: Combining information from different sources while maintaining accuracy.

    With these needs in mind, let’s explore the various methods to compare sheets in Excel.


    Method 1: Using Excel’s View Side by Side Feature

    One of the simplest ways to compare two sheets is by using the “View Side by Side” feature. This allows you to see both sheets simultaneously.

    Steps:
    1. Open the Workbook: Open the Excel workbook containing the sheets you want to compare.
    2. Select the Sheets: Click on the first sheet tab you want to compare.
    3. View Side by Side:
      • Go to the View tab on the Ribbon.
      • Click on View Side by Side.
      • Select the second sheet you want to compare.
    4. Scroll Synchronization: If you want to scroll through both sheets simultaneously, ensure the Synchronous Scrolling option is enabled in the View tab.

    This method is straightforward and allows for a visual comparison, but it may not be the most efficient for large datasets.


    Method 2: Using Conditional Formatting

    Conditional formatting can highlight differences between two sheets, making it easier to spot discrepancies.

    Steps:
    1. Select the Range: Go to the first sheet and select the range of cells you want to compare.
    2. Conditional Formatting:
      • Click on the Home tab.
      • Select Conditional Formatting > New Rule.
    3. Use a Formula:
      • Choose Use a formula to determine which cells to format.
      • Enter a formula like =A1<>Sheet2!A1 (adjust the cell references as needed).
    4. Set Formatting: Choose a formatting style (like a fill color) to highlight the differences.
    5. Apply: Click OK to apply the formatting.

    This method visually indicates where the differences lie, making it easier to analyze the data.


    Method 3: Using Excel Formulas

    Formulas can be a powerful way to compare sheets, especially for more complex comparisons.

    Steps:
    1. Create a New Sheet: Add a new sheet to your workbook for the comparison results.
    2. Enter Comparison Formula:
      • In cell A1 of the new sheet, enter a formula like =IF(Sheet1!A1=Sheet2!A1, "Match", "Difference").
      • Drag the fill handle to apply this formula to the entire range you want to compare.
    3. Analyze Results: The new sheet will now display “Match” or “Difference” based on the comparison.

    This method provides a clear, textual representation of the comparison, which can be useful for reporting.


    Method 4: Using Excel Add-Ins

    For users who frequently need to compare sheets, Excel add-ins can provide advanced features and streamline the process.

    • Inquire Add-In: This built-in add-in (available in Excel 2013 and later) allows for detailed comparisons, including cell differences, formulas, and formatting.
    • Spreadsheet Compare: A standalone tool that provides a comprehensive comparison of Excel files, highlighting differences in a user-friendly interface.
    Steps to Use Inquire:
    1. Enable Inquire: Go to File > Options > Add-Ins. In the Manage box, select COM Add-ins and click Go. Check the box for Inquire and click OK.
    2. Open Inquire: Go to the Inquire tab on the Ribbon.
    3. Compare Files: Click on Compare Files and select the two sheets or workbooks you want to compare.

    Using add-ins can save time and provide more detailed insights into your data.
